Inconsistent silence: the Times editorial page forgets Atlantic Yards subsidies
Atlantic Yards Report
Norman Oder points out how The New York Times has stated that public subsidies are unnecessary for Atlantic Yards, but doggedly keeps silent even as the City has doubled its subsidy to $205 million.
AYR also wonders how The Times manages to remain silent over the issue of the demolition the Ward Bakery.
